Over a hundred years old the Cathedral has some of the most amazing architecture in London. The Cathedral is a quite space in the heart of London where you can get away from the hustle and bustle of life and London. Early Christian Byzantine in architectural style by the Victorian architect John Francis Bentley the first stone was laid in 1895, however the Cathedral has never been truly finished. The Cathedral has 14 sculptures showing the Stations of the Cross. One of the fines views of London can be seen from bell tower and is well worth the climb.
